There's a bar in Kentucky that makes smoked old fashioned cocktails and they present them in a Booker's case. They put the cocktail in the case, fill the case with smoke, put the glass on it and then bring it out to you. You pull the glass up, the smoke pours out and you remove the cocktail.

Garrisons brows cowboy bourbon comes in a wooden case as well blood oath. There are actual bars that are specifically old fashioned bars. They serve most of their cocktails with your choice of smoke/wood.
